• формат pdf
  • размер 1,50 МБ
  • добавлен 20 декабря 2011 г.
Смирнов С.И. Уроки программирования: Pascal - Delphi
Красноярск, 2011
Данный курс программирования оформлен в виде занятий и предназначен для изучения языка программирования Pascal школьниками и студентами младших курсов ВУЗов. Курс состоит из двух частей: изучение Turbo Pascal 7.0 и изучение Delphi. Первая часть курса посвящена изучению языка Pascal: его операторов, основных конструкций, типов данных и т.д. Вторая часть — программирование под Windows в Delphi.
Оглавление:
Алгоритмы и способы их описания. Упрощенная модель компилятора. Задания для самостоятельной работы.
Структура программы на языке Pascal. Типы данных в языке Pascal. Понятие выражения, операции и операнда. Понятие оператора. Простые операторы. Задания для самостоятельной работы.
Структурные операторы: Унифицированная структура «развилка». Условная конструкция If-Then-Else. Задания для самостоятельной работы.
Цикл с постусловием. Цикл с предусловием. Цикл с параметром. Задания для самостоятельной работы.
Решение квадратных уравнений. Игра «Угадай число». Задания для самостоятельной работы .
Унифицированная структура выбора. Оператор выбора Case. Задания для самостоятельной работы.
Калькулятор. Некоторые математические функции и процедуры Turbo Pascal
7.0. Задания для самостоятельной работы.
Структурированные типы данных: массив. Строковый тип данных. Типизированные константы. Задания для самостоятельной работы.
Сортировка массивов. Двоичный поиск. Задания для самостоятельной работы.
Процедуры и функции. Кодирование информации. Задания для самостоятельной работы Модули. Задания для самостоятельной работы.
Файлы. «Алекс – Юстасу». Задания для самостоятельной работы.
Записи. Нетипизированные файлы. Создание bmp файла. Задания для самостоятельной работы.
Интегрированная среда разработки. Изменяем привычное. Задания для самостоятельной работы.
Игра «Угадай число». Задания для самостоятельной работы.
Поиск файла на диске. Класс: список строк TStringlist. Отображение картинок. Создание галереи просмотра картинок. Создание процедуры открытия картинки. Обработка событий. Полный текст программы.
Летающая тарелка.